Output 5a4bbbbd3131ceb7e70e821b25a99f26255e441d7fd3f5ba86cc840cff91ad68:3

value
17920808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e4384bb130b5526fb23cca177e0d4b944bb69f OP_EQUAL
address
MCipmQHnjKBxnpgyKgnZUL5Y47ZTva3KJK
transaction
5a4bbbbd3131ceb7e70e821b25a99f26255e441d7fd3f5ba86cc840cff91ad68
spent
true